Shooting Master is a video game in the action genre developed by SEGA Enterprises Ltd. and published by SEGA Enterprises Ltd. originally released in 1985. It is currently playable on Arcade.

The year was 1985, and the arcade scene was booming with innovation and excitement. It was during this time that the arcade game Shooting Master was released, captivating players with its unique blend of shooting and puzzle gameplay. Developed by Sanritsu and published by Sega, Shooting Master quickly became a hit among gamers of all ages.

The premise of the game was simple yet addictive. Players controlled a crosshair cursor and had to shoot various targets that appeared on the screen. The targets ranged from moving objects to hidden objects that required precision and strategy to hit. Shooting Master featured six stages, each with its own distinct challenges and obstacles. This variety kept players engaged and eager to progress through each level.

What made Shooting Master stand out among other arcade games of that time was its use of a light gun controller. This revolutionary accessory allowed players to physically aim and shoot at the targets on the screen, making the gameplay more immersive and realistic. The light gun was a major selling point for the game, and it added an extra layer of excitement for players.

Another feature that set Shooting Master apart from other arcade games was its multiplayer mode. Two players could compete against each other simultaneously, adding a competitive element to the gameplay. This made the game even more enjoyable to play with friends, and it added a social aspect to the experience.

One of the most challenging aspects of Shooting Master was its bonus stages. These stages required players to memorize the location of hidden targets and hit them within a specific time limit. These bonus stages not only tested the player's shooting skills but also their memory and reflexes, adding an extra level of difficulty to the game.

The graphics and sound of Shooting Master were also notable for its time. The vibrant and detailed visuals of the game showcased the advanced graphics capabilities of the arcade machines. The music and sound effects were also well-crafted, adding to the overall immersive experience of the game.

Shooting Master may have been released in 1985, but its legacy has lived on throughout the years. The game has been ported to various consoles and has even been included in retro arcade collections. Its addictive gameplay and innovative use of the light gun controller continue to be praised by gamers even today.

Other names: シューティングマスター Year: 1985 Platform: Arcade Country of release: Japan Genre: Action Publisher: SEGA Enterprises Ltd. Developer: SEGA Enterprises Ltd.
